Nuclear fusion is one of the most promising sources of clean energy. It has the potential to provide unlimited, sustainable energy without the dangerous radioactive waste associated with other forms of energy production. However, while nuclear fusion has been a dream for scientists for many decades, it has been difficult to achieve in reality. To understand why, it’s important to know the basics of nuclear fusion and what needs to be done to make it a reality.

The history of AI (Artificial Intelligence) can be traced back to the 1950s, when British mathematician and computer scientist Alan Turing published his seminal paper “Computing Machinery and Intelligence.” In this paper, Turing introduced the concept of the “Turing Test,” which proposed a method for determining whether a machine could be considered intelligent.
The ethics of using AI to generate original content is a complex and nuanced topic that has garnered increasing attention in recent years. As AI technology continues to advance, it has become possible for machines to generate human-like text, allowing them to write articles, stories, and other forms of content. While this has the potential to greatly enhance the efficiency and productivity of the writing process, it also raises important ethical questions about the role of AI in the creation of original content.
